Turnipton

You made a suggestion, I provided feedback. Either way, this design doesn't work as you intended. You haven't specified that the commander needs to be cast from your command zone to get the Treasures, so repeatedly casting your commander from your hand will net you mana. If you wanted to make this type of effect *safely,* make it a trigger for the commander going back to the command zone, like \[\[Myth Unbound\]\]. That way, they're getting mana for the next time they try to cast it, but they HAVE to play it from the CZ.

PlasmaBigCannon

This would not effect commander tax right? Because it’s technically an additional cost separate from the cost of the commander?


Gooberpf

Cost reducers can affect Commander tax - you add all additional costs first and then reductions after. You can casting cost reduce kickers etc as well, as long as they're part of the upfront casting cost of the spell, e.g., you can casting cost reduce [[Clockspinning]] Buyback, but not the triggered ability of [[Eldrazi Obligator]]. This is how Myth Unbound works as intended.
